3. Can you explain a little bit about the Help to Buy Scheme in Bournemouth and what this entails?

Sure, in the UK, just like the US we saw a large economic downturn in the last decade. As a result, people, especially young people and first time buyers, were unable to get enough of a deposit to buy a new home. The UK Government launched the Help to Buy Scheme which means that first time buyers can now get onto the property ladder with as a little as a five percent deposit.

The Help to Buy Scheme in Bournemouth is only available for first time buyers and on new-builds, so I partner up with property developers in the town to open up this possibility for my clients. It's a great scheme and has helped hundreds of young people in the town so far. I offer advice on this and help those buyers get onto the market where otherwise they would struggle.
